Scottish taunts no worry for McCarthy

James McCarthy insists he has absolutely no qualms about playing for Ireland in Scotland in the Euro 2016 qualifiers, despite anticipating renewed echoes of the abuse he received as a Glasgow-born player with Hamilton who decided to declare for the Republic.

“I’m delighted — to be honest, I’m looking forward to it,” he says. “Obviously there will be boos probably, but I’ve got used to it now.

“For a few years I had (it) playing in the SPL and in the lower divisions in the Scottish League — that’s part and parcel of the game.
